Unit Specific Job Responsibilities:

Camp Counselors serve youth participants ages six to twelve years old by fostering experiential opportunities throughout the daily schedule of camp activities at various locations. These opportunities include but are not limited to: teambuilding sportdevelopment fitness and wellness practices nature immersions and artistic adventures which promote enhance and support the development of participants healthy relationships with themselves their peers and recreational activities.

Position duties include the following:

  • Facilitate activities to promote and enhance individual and group growth development and wellness
  • Demonstrate proficient skills in positive behavior modification strategies
  • Maintain consistent supervision of small groups of youth participants throughout the entire camp season
  • Provide effective verbal instruction and preactivity safety briefings
  • Manage risk and promote wellbeing of participants teammates and self
  • Support Youth Program special events facilities and services
  • Assist with set up take down opening closing cleaning and other duties as directed
  • Develop professional relationships with coworkers participants and their families
  • Assist campers with and promote proper usage of equipment
  • Administer First Aid/CPR/AED when necessary
  • Prevent injuries by eliminating hazardous situations and behaviors
  • Enforce rules regulations and policies
  • Complete reports including accident incident attendance and daily staff notes
  • Inspect facilities and equipment for unsafe conditions remedy the condition and or notify Supervisors
  • Participate in departmental and unit trainings
  • Assist supervisors and professional staff with additional duties as assigned
Advertised Salary:

$15 per hour

Minimum Requirements:

This position is open to UF Students. All employees must maintain a minimum 2.0 grade point average. Registered students are employed on a parttime basis up to 20 hours per week. Registered students are employed on a parttime basis up to 20 hours per week.

*Federal Work Study students are encouraged to apply.

  • Must have a valid drivers license
  • Must have current CPR First Aid and AED certification or be able to obtain within 30 days of hire
  • Will be required to successfully complete a level 2 background check
  • Maintain a clear criminal record
  • Comfortable working in heat and moving for long periods of time
  • Ability to work harmoniously with the staff youth and their families
  • Availability to work a regular schedule for 6 hour stretches MondayFriday 7:30a6:00p including in the summer and over academic breaks
  • Remain compliant on all required trainings (including but not limited to: GET803 ITT102 OOC101 PRV802 YCS800 GET811
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Youth Programs Leadership Course
  • Experience providing exceptional customer service
  • Previous youth group facilitation
  • Experience designing creating and adapting youth program experiences to meet the needs of the participants
